Pamela M. Lynch, 69, of Ridgway, died on Saturday, July 18, 2026, at Cleveland Clinic following a lengthy illness.
She was born on March 25, 1957, in Ridgway, the daughter of the late Vincenco R. and Gloria M. Elia Borrello.
On August 12, 1978, she married Steve Lynch, who survives.
A lifelong resident of the Ridgway area, Pam was a proud graduate of Ridgway High School before earning her teaching degree from Villa Maria College. She dedicated many years to educating local children through the Ridgway School District. Pam found great joy in opening her home to family and friends, sharing delicious meals and creating cherished memories around the table. Her greatest pride and happiness came from her beloved grandchildren, whom she adored beyond measure. She also treasured the opportunity to travel, with her unforgettable trips to Italy remaining one of her proudest experiences. A true Disney enthusiast, Pam never lost her sense of wonder and found delight in the magic and memories that Disney brought throughout her life.
In addition to her husband of 47 years, she is survived by 3 sons; Patrick (Erin) Lynch of Granby, CT, Zachary Lynch (Frankie Gardner) of Ridgway, and Michael (Rachelle) Lynch of Bethel Park, 9 grandchildren; Bianca, Zachary, Sage, Danica, Emma, Abby, James, Haley, and Fallon. She is also survived by a brother, Sam Borrello of Ridgway, and several nieces and nephews.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by a brother, Philip Borrello.
